Trimester end exams for each course are typically scheduled on Fridays, Saturdays, or Sundays. For each
course, students can choose between two available date and time options for trimester end exams—making it
easier to plan around personal and professional commitments.
Students must adhere to the published exam schedule, rules, and guidelines announced prior to each exam.
Students may update their preferred exam centre each trimester, subject to availability.
EXAMS: STUDENTS OUTSIDE INDIA
Students residing outside India will take their exams in an online proctored format
from their country of residence.
All requirements and technical guidelines will be shared in advance to ensure readiness.

Introduction to Cloud Computing: History and evolution of cloud computing, Key characteristics and service models (IaaS, PaaS, SaaS),
Cloud deployment models (Public, Private, Hybrid, and Multi-cloud); Cloud Platforms: Overview of major cloud platforms: AWS, Microsoft
Azure, Google Cloud Platform (GCP), Introduction to platform-specific tools and services; Virtualization and Networking: Concepts of
virtualization and virtual machines, Containers and orchestration with Kubernetes/docker, Software-defined networking (SDN) and virtual
private clouds (VPCs); Cloud Storage and Databases: Types of cloud storage: Object, Block, and File storage, Managed database services:
Relational and NoSQL databases, HDFS; Backup, recovery, and disaster recovery in the cloud; Cloud Security and Compliance: Identity and
Access Management (IAM), Encryption and data protection strategies, Compliance standards: GDPR, HIPAA, ISO 27001, Threat detection
and response; DevOps and Automation in the Cloud: Introduction to DevOps and its importance in cloud environments, CI/CD pipelines
and deployment automation, Infrastructure as Code (IaC) with tools like Terraform and AWS CloudFormation.
